mac80211: always print a message when disconnecting

Make sure there's at least a debug message whenever the
connection to the AP is terminated.

Also change one message from wiphy_debug() to the common
mlme_dbg().

Signed-off-by: Johannes Berg <johannes.berg@intel.com>
